422086 2006-01-18 04:02:00 im planning to get a 6600GT 128mb AGP but I was wondering whether my 350W PSU is up to the task. i dont have many components in my computer; only 1 HDD, 1 DVD burner, 2 sticks of RAM, cpu, mobo and a modem. im on a very tight budget, under NZ$300. i dont really want to buy a new PSU as I havent installed any PSU's in the past. any ideas? jason_f90 (3544)
422087 2006-01-18 04:06:00 That will greatly depend on what type of CPU you have and what brand your PSU is (is it an el cheapo type or something good like enermax??) Agent_24 (57)

422090 2006-01-18 04:24:00 You'll need to provide more details about your power supply, but its probably should be fine. Just because the system will boot and play some games doesnt nessesarily means its fine. Pete O'Neil (6584)
422091 2006-01-19 04:18:00 My cpu is an AMD Athlon XP 2500+ (Barton Core) and my psu brand is Raidmax (same as my case). jason_f90 (3544)
422092 2006-01-19 08:25:00 It would appear that raidmax is not one of the good types... you might have some problems with it but maybe not... if there is a problem you'll get bluescreen errors or the drivers will notify you that the card is not getting sufficient power Agent_24 (57)
